In-Depth Research with People of Influence
A joint venture between leading online market research agency YouGov and business consultant Carole Stone, YouGovStone delivers in-depth insight by asking people of influence their views on subjects that matter to us all.

Our Research Offer
YouGovStone provides a highly distinctive research service, drawing on the opinions of men and women who are leaders and innovators - the 'influentials'.
Staying in touch with the views and attitudes of people at the top of their field has always been of paramount importance for progressive organisations. YouGovStone has now established large ThinkTank panel of these opinion formers, drawn from a wide variety of occupations and backgrounds, to make that possible.
From debates, lunches and workshops to ad hoc surveys, reputation audits, depth interviews and deliberative projects, all with 'influentials', YouGovStone research enables our clients to understand what the people who influence our society really think.
